About the Genesys GCP-GCX Exam

The Genesys GCP-GCX Exam is designed to assess your proficiency in Genesys technologies and solutions related to customer experience. It focuses on various aspects of the Genesys Customer Experience platform, including installation, configuration, integration, and troubleshooting.

To obtain the Genesys GCP-GCX certification, you need to pass this exam, which demonstrates your competence and expertise in implementing and managing Genesys solutions effectively.

Preparing for the Genesys GCP-GCX Exam

Proper preparation is the key to success in any exam. Here are some actionable tips to help you prepare effectively for the Genesys GCP-GCX Exam:

  1. Review the Exam Blueprint: Familiarize yourself with the exam blueprint provided by Genesys. It outlines the exam objectives, domains, and the weightage assigned to each section. This will help you understand which topics require more focus during your preparation.
  2. Utilize Official Resources: Visit the Genesys website and explore the official resources available for exam preparation. These may include study guides, practice exams, and documentation related to Genesys CX solutions. Utilize these resources to gain a comprehensive understanding of the topics covered in the exam.
  3. Create a Study Plan: Develop a study plan that covers all the exam domains and allows you to allocate sufficient time for each topic. A structured study plan will help you stay organized and ensure you cover all the necessary material before the exam.
  4. Hands-on Experience: Genesys technologies are best learned through practical experience. Whenever possible, set up a lab environment to gain hands-on experience with Genesys CX solutions. This will enhance your understanding of the platform and its functionalities.
  5. Practice with Sample Questions: Practice makes perfect. Use sample questions and practice exams to assess your knowledge and identify areas that require further improvement. This will also familiarize you with the exam format and help you manage your time effectively during the actual exam.
  6. Join Online Communities: Engage with the Genesys community by joining relevant online forums, discussion boards, or social media groups. These platforms provide an opportunity to interact with experts, ask questions, and gain valuable insights from those who have already passed the exam.
  7. Stay Updated: Keep yourself updated with the latest developments in Genesys CX solutions and technologies. Follow the official Genesys blog, subscribe to relevant industry newsletters, and explore online resources to stay informed about any updates or changes that may impact the exam.

Question 5:

  • In Azure Resource Manager (ARM) REST APIs, creating or updating a resource is done with a PUT request to the resource’s exact URL (idempotent operation). This means you can repeatedly call the same PUT and it will create the resource if it doesn’t exist or update it if it does.
  • POST is used to create resources under a collection (without a predefined name), which would generate a new resource id each time and is not suitable when you need a single, known resource name and a single endpoint/key to consolidate billing and access.
  • For Question 5, you’re creating a new resource at a specific path (with a known resource name) to provide a single key/endpoint for multiple services. Therefore, PUT is the correct method.
